#e593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e593ed is composed of 89.8% red, 57.6%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.4% cyan, 38%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 294.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 75.3%. #e593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cb27db.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#e593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e593ed has RGB values of R:229, G:147,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15045613.

Shades and Tints of #e593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020a is the darkest color, while #fdf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e593ed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1bfc1 is the less saturated color, while #f184fc is the most saturated one.
